    <description>&lt;P&gt;eBay accepts only two methods of verifying your age.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;One is by providing credit card details for verification. The card will not be saved or charged, unless you also choose to use it to pay. The other is by using a third-party partner of eBay called VerifyMyAge (details online).&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;eBay has obviously decided not to accept verification by methods which involve the production and return of documents before buying.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Don't dismiss the idea of getting a credit card, even a prepaid one where you can choose how much to load on it. Paying by credit card provides buyers with an extra layer of buyer protection that lasts for 120 days, compared to eBay's own 30 day money back guarantee. It's especially worthwhile for purchases over £100 when it also provides the protection of the Consumer Credit Act 1974.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
